python + OpenCV的读取、显示、保存图像

作为代码的搬运工,我又来了,这次是python + OpenCV的图像识别,现说明我自己的学习版本:

python3.7
OpenCV3.4
PyCharm2.3

因为这是基础,直接上代码:

"""
2019.10.20
读入一幅图像、显示图像,以及保存图像
学习的函数:cv2.imread(),cv2.imshow(),cv2.imwrite()
"""
import numpy as np
import cv2

#   读入图像函数,参数“0”代表以灰色图读入,“1”代表彩色图
img = cv2.imread('ziji_1.jpg',0)

"""
因不能调整窗口大小,故有以下代码【可以手动调整窗口大小】
cv2.namedWindow('image',cv2.WINDOW_NORMAL)
"""

#   显示图像函数
cv2.imshow('image',img)

#   参数“0”表示一直显示,若有按键按下则执行下一行代码;“2000”表示等待2秒后自动执行下一行代码
cv2.waitKey(0)

#   保存图像
cv2.imwrite('gray.png',img)

#   关闭所有窗口
cv2.destroyAllWindows()

你可能感兴趣的:(毕设过程)